大数据开发,揭开神秘面纱,探索真实工作内容
大数据开发揭开神秘面纱,揭示其实际工作内容。大数据开发涉及数据收集、存储、管理和分析,旨在从海量数据中提取有价值的信息。它利用先进的技术和算法,处理复杂数据集,帮助企业和组织做出更明智的决策。大数据开发人员需要具备编程技能、数据分析能力和对最新技术的了解,以应对不断变化的行业需求。通过深入探索大数据开发的工作内容,我们可以更好地理解其在现代商业和社会中的重要作用。
本文目录导读:
- 1.1 什么是大数据开发?
- 1.2 大数据开发的背景
- 2.1 数据采集
- 2.2 数据清洗
- 2.3 数据整合
- 2.4 数据存储与管理
- 2.5 数据分析与挖掘
- 2.6 数据可视化
- 3.1 Hadoop生态系统
- 3.2 Spark框架
- 3.3 Python/R语言
- 3.4 SQL/NoSQL数据库
随着科技的飞速发展,大数据已经成为各行各业不可或缺的一部分,大数据开发作为这一领域的核心力量,承担着将海量数据转化为有价值信息的重任,对于许多人来说,大数据开发仍然是一个充满神秘色彩的职业,本文将深入探讨大数据开发的实际工作内容,揭开其神秘的面纱。
一、大数据开发的定义与背景
1 什么是大数据开发?
大数据开发是指利用先进的计算机技术和算法对大量数据进行收集、整理、分析和挖掘的过程,大数据开发的目标是从海量的数据中提取有用的信息,为企业和组织提供决策支持。
2 大数据开发的背景
在当今的信息时代,数据的产生速度和规模呈指数级增长,企业需要有效地管理和分析这些数据来获取竞争优势,大数据开发正是为了满足这种需求而应运而生。
二、大数据开发的主要任务
1 数据采集
数据采集是大数据开发的第一步,这一阶段涉及从各种来源收集原始数据,如网站日志、社交媒体、传感器等,数据采集的质量直接影响到后续的分析结果。
2 数据清洗
收集到的数据往往存在噪声和不完整性等问题,需要对数据进行清洗,去除错误和不相关的信息,以确保分析的准确性。
3 数据整合
不同来源的数据格式各异,需要进行标准化处理以实现统一管理,还需要考虑数据的时效性和一致性。
4 数据存储与管理
经过处理的干净数据需要被妥善地存储和管理起来,这通常涉及到数据库设计和技术架构的选择。
5 数据分析与挖掘
这是大数据开发的灵魂所在,通过运用统计学、机器学习等技术手段,从大量数据中发现隐藏的模式和趋势,为企业提供洞察力。
6 数据可视化
为了让人们更容易理解复杂的分析结果,常常需要将其转化为图表或图形等形式进行展示,这不仅有助于提高工作效率,还能增强报告的可读性。
三、大数据开发的工具与技术
1 Hadoop生态系统
Hadoop是一种流行的开源分布式计算平台,适用于大规模数据处理,它包括MapReduce编程模型以及HDFS文件系统等组件。
2 Spark框架
Spark是一款快速内存计算引擎,能够加速数据分析过程,相比传统的MapReduce模式,Spark的性能更优且易于扩展。
3 Python/R语言
Python和R都是常用的统计编程语言,拥有丰富的库函数和数据可视化工具,非常适合用于数据分析领域。
4 SQL/NoSQL数据库
不同的应用场景可能需要使用不同类型的数据库技术,关系型数据库(如MySQL)适合结构化数据的存储;而无关系型数据库(如MongoDB)则更适合半结构化和非结构化数据的存储。
四、大数据开发的职业前景
随着数字化时代的到来,大数据开发人才的需求日益旺盛,据预测,未来几年内相关岗位的市场缺口将持续扩大,掌握大数据技术的专业人才将成为职场上的香饽饽。
大数据开发也是一个不断发展的领域,新的算法、技术和应用层出不穷,要求从业者具备持续学习和适应能力。
五、结语
大数据开发是一项集成了多种技能的综合型工作,它不仅考验了技术人员的技术水平,还要求他们具备良好的沟通能力和团队合作精神,只有深入了解并熟练掌握相关知识和工具,才能在这个充满机遇和挑战的行业中脱颖而出,让我们共同期待大数据开发的美好未来吧!
热门标签: #大数据开发 #工作内容